Output 50a3979e0168db91573fd18437b0fb49e3e243f869308f3888a43637afc2d5b1:3

value
31363407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6dcf1b3c5566d4aeef8c82d2c2bb45fbd65a19 OP_EQUAL
address
MEsH8fzJzAcrWhk515M5vjBQndaHHZAS92
transaction
50a3979e0168db91573fd18437b0fb49e3e243f869308f3888a43637afc2d5b1
spent
true